Dear All,

Can you please suggest me what to do to acheive the below setup using Cisco router.

My  main objective is to be able to achieve two-stage dialing i.e. dialing   into the route using the POTs/PSTN line which would be attached to it,  entering  the desired telephone number using DTMF, and then having the  call sent  to our Class 4 softswitch using SIP, for onward termination.

I have been suggested to use either of the below modular access routers with VIC2- 2FXO Card.

  • Cisco 2611
  • Cisco 2621xm
  • Cisco 2651xm

Do  you think this setup will work. Will I be able to dial into the router  by using the PSTN Line attached to it and then after a announcement/beep  or any other indication dial the 2nd number which is our desired number  and then that number gets routed to our class 4 switch.

Can anyone explain how this setup will actually work?
